County EMS seeks to reference state ambulance rate rule in fee schedule to avoid yearly ordinance changes
Summary
San Juan County EMS staff asked commissioners to update the consolidated county fee schedule to reference the state administrative rule for ambulance rates, so the county’s fees track annual state rate changes without repeated public hearings.
San Juan County Emergency Medical Services staff asked commissioners on Oct. 21 to update the county’s consolidated fee schedule so ground ambulance and standby fees reference the state EMS administrative rule rather than hard‑coded amounts in county ordinance.
